Default VOR antenna wiring

I have a Bob Archer wingtip VOR antenna. The instructions call out the wingtip light/strobe wiring run along the short side of the antenna. Trouble is, unlike the older wingtips, the wiring exits the corner of the wingtip about halfway along that "short side". Should I run the wire out to the end of the short leg of the antenna before running it back to the wing or should I run it straight to the antenna leg (about mid-way) then run it along that leg, back to the wing?
